Ambulatory blood pressure and hypertension control in children with autosomal recessive polycystic kidney disease: clinical experience from two central European tertiary centres
Conclusion:
The prevalence of ambulatory hypertension is very high in children with ARPKD, while the control of hypertension improves over time.
